FAQs About Septic Services in Centereach

Every three to five years is the standard interval recommended for Suffolk County homeowners to ensure solids are removed before they can clog your drainage field. Factors like your household size and the age of your system in Centereach may require more frequent attention to prevent backups.
Most residential properties in Centereach use 1,000, 1,500, or 2,000-gallon tanks to manage wastewater for single-family homes. Larger tanks are often required for newer constructions or homes with high water usage to meet New York State Department of Health requirements.
Yes, you must obtain a formal permit from the Suffolk County Department of Health and follow New York State Appendix 75-A regulations for any new installation or major repair. This process ensures that your system is designed by a licensed professional to protect the local groundwater and sole-source aquifer.
Our local sandy loam drains very quickly, which is excellent for waste disposal but creates a higher risk of untreated contaminants reaching the drinking water table. Regular maintenance ensures that your tank properly separates solids, preventing them from washing into these fast-draining soils and causing environmental damage.
Homeowners in this area usually pay between $300 and $550 for a professional pumping and cleaning service from a local technician. This price generally covers the labor and disposal fees for a standard 1,000-gallon tank, though costs can increase if the tank is buried exceptionally deep or hasn't been serviced in many years.

Local Septic Landscape

The sandy loam soil prevalent across Centereach offers rapid drainage compared to the heavy clay found in other parts of the state, but this fast percolation requires careful management to protect our local groundwater. Because our water table fluctuates between 3 and 20 feet deep, technicians must account for varying pressure and drainage rates when performing routine pumping and cleaning. Whether your property is near the local parks or closer to the Amityville area, your system components likely sit beneath a 42 to 48-inch frost line, making deep-set burial a necessity for preventing winter freeze-ups and pipe damage.

Regulations & Permitting

In Suffolk County, all septic installations and major repairs must strictly adhere to Appendix 75-A of the New York State Sanitary Code and local Department of Health guidelines. Because Long Island sits atop a sole-source aquifer, Centereach residents face specific regulations designed to prevent nitrogen runoff from contaminating our primary drinking water supply. Homeowners are required to obtain a permit through the county health department for any system modifications, and certain sensitive areas near the coast or local waterways may require the installation of enhanced treatment units to meet modern environmental standards.

Environmental Factors

The humid continental climate of New York brings heavy spring rains and significant snowmelt, which can temporarily saturate the soil around Centereach and lead to sluggish drainage. This moderate flood risk, combined with the sandy soil's tendency to move contaminants quickly toward the drinking water aquifer, makes the recommended 3 to 5-year pumping cycle vital for protecting the local ecosystem. Routine cleaning prevents solids from escaping the tank and clogging the leach field, which is especially critical during periods of high groundwater typical of the Long Island region.

Local Cost Factors

A standard septic pumping service in Centereach typically ranges from $300 to $550, depending on the specific size of your tank and how easily the access lids can be reached. Factors such as the depth of your tankβ€”which must be buried at least four feet to stay below the New York frost lineβ€”and the degree of sludge buildup will influence the final price for professional cleaning. Maintaining a regular service schedule with a local Suffolk County specialist prevents the need for much more expensive emergency excavations or total system failures that can cost thousands more.
